laravel

  • Laravel Blade @forelse 指令:优雅处理空集合显示

    本文将详细介绍如何在Laravel Blade模板中优雅地处理数据库查询结果为空的情况。通过使用Blade内置的@forelse指令,开发者可以轻松地在集合为空时显示自定义消息,而在有数据时正常遍历显示,从而避免了手动检查集合是否为空的繁琐逻辑,提升了代码的可读性和健壮性。 在web开发中,从数据库…

    2025年12月11日
    000
  • Laravel Blade:使用@forelse实现空数据时的优雅提示

    本文旨在介绍如何在Laravel Blade模板中优雅地处理从数据库查询返回的空集合。传统上,开发者可能尝试在@foreach循环内部进行条件判断,但这无法处理集合本身为空的情况。我们将深入探讨Laravel Blade提供的@forelse指令,它能有效解决这一问题,允许在集合为空时显示自定义消息…

    2025年12月11日
    000
  • Laravel Blade:如何优雅地处理循环中的空数据情况

    本文详细介绍了在Laravel Blade模板中,如何优雅地处理从数据库查询返回的空数据集。通过深入分析传统@foreach循环在处理空数据时的局限性,并引入Laravel提供的@forelse指令,展示了如何简洁高效地在数据为空时显示特定消息,从而提升用户体验和代码可读性。 在Web开发中,我们经…

    2025年12月11日
    000
  • Laravel Blade中处理空集合:@forelse指令的优雅应用

    本文详细阐述了在Laravel Blade模板中如何优雅地处理数据库查询返回的空集合。通过对比传统的@foreach结合手动判断,文章重点介绍了Laravel提供的@forelse指令,它能自动区分集合是否包含数据,并在数据为空时显示预设信息,从而简化代码逻辑,提升模板的可读性和健壮性。 在web开…

    2025年12月11日
    000
  • 解决 Laravel Monolog 1.x 异常链堆栈追踪不完整的问题

    在 Laravel 应用中,Monolog 1.x 版本的 LineFormatter 在处理异常链时,可能无法完整输出所有前置异常的堆栈追踪,导致调试困难。本文将深入探讨这一问题,并提供两种主要解决方案:一是推荐升级 Monolog 至 2.x 版本,该版本已修复此问题;二是针对无法升级的情况,指…

    2025年12月11日
    000
  • 优化 Laravel 日志:显示完整的链式异常堆栈追踪

    本文探讨了 Laravel 应用中 Monolog 1.x 在处理链式异常时,日志输出无法显示完整堆栈追踪的问题。默认情况下,Monolog 仅记录链中最新异常的堆栈信息,导致难以追溯原始错误源。教程提供了两种解决方案:一是推荐升级 Monolog 到 2.x 版本以利用其内置修复;二是对于 Mon…

    2025年12月11日
    000
  • 如何使用Laragon快速搭建PHP环境 Laragon一键PHP环境配置教程

    如何使用Laragon快速搭建PHP环境 Laragon一键PHP环境配置教程如何使用Laragon快速搭建PHP环境 Laragon一键PHP环境配置教程如何使用Laragon快速搭建PHP环境 Laragon一键PHP环境配置教程如何使用Laragon快速搭建PHP环境 Laragon一键PHP环境配置教程

    laragon搭建php环境的核心步骤包括:1.下载完整版laragon;2.安装并选择合适路径;3.首次启动时配置web服务器、数据库和php版本;4.启动服务;5.通过快速创建功能新建项目;6.自动解析本地域名访问项目;7.使用集成工具管理数据库。laragon优势在于便携性、自动化虚拟主机配置…

    2025年12月11日 用户投稿
    100
  • 如何配置PHP环境支持SMTP邮件发送 PHP发送邮件模块设置方法

    如何配置PHP环境支持SMTP邮件发送 PHP发送邮件模块设置方法如何配置PHP环境支持SMTP邮件发送 PHP发送邮件模块设置方法如何配置PHP环境支持SMTP邮件发送 PHP发送邮件模块设置方法如何配置PHP环境支持SMTP邮件发送 PHP发送邮件模块设置方法

    配置php环境以支持smtp邮件发送的核心答案是:1. 修改php.ini文件中的smtp、smtp_port、sendmail_from等参数,并启用php_openssl扩展,重启web服务器;2. 使用phpmailer库实现更安全、功能完善的邮件发送逻辑。具体来说,第一步需找到php.ini…

    2025年12月11日 用户投稿
    100
  • 优化 Laravel 日志:解决 Monolog 链式异常堆栈跟踪不完整问题

    优化 Laravel 日志:解决 Monolog 链式异常堆栈跟踪不完整问题 本文探讨了 laravel 6.x 中 monolog 1.x 在处理链式异常时,日志输出仅包含末端异常堆栈跟踪的局限性。针对这一痛点,教程提供了两种解决方案:推荐升级 monolog 至 2.x 版本,该版本已修复此问题…

    2025年12月11日
    000
  • 如何让PHP环境配置在本地和生产同步 PHP.ini配置一致化操作

    如何让PHP环境配置在本地和生产同步 PHP.ini配置一致化操作如何让PHP环境配置在本地和生产同步 PHP.ini配置一致化操作如何让PHP环境配置在本地和生产同步 PHP.ini配置一致化操作如何让PHP环境配置在本地和生产同步 PHP.ini配置一致化操作

    直接复制php.ini文件不是保持php环境配置同步的最佳实践,核心在于建立智能配置管理机制。首先,应维护一个基准php.ini模板,纳入版本控制系统,包含通用设置如错误报告、内存限制、扩展启用等。其次,差异配置应通过环境变量或独立配置文件管理,如数据库连接、日志路径、xdebug启用等,避免硬编码…

    2025年12月11日 用户投稿
    000
关注微信